The Evarir of the Lumidrim sits in solitude at the centre of the Leumalin barracks, a wide-stretched map of Anthos before him with a homely bowl of soup steaming beside it. Recent events had shaken the procedure at which the Lumidrim were set to be established, what with what was being dubbed the mightiest war for decades echoing just beyond Malinor's borders. Beyond his tidy beard hid bitten lips, gnawing at themselves in consideration of what the next move was. The Uzg had remained awfully quiet as of late, and with the recent goings-on at Leumalin's plaza, a chill seeped into Bircalin's spine. But paranoia and suspicion wasn't on the bearded Elf's mind, merely the anticipation of what might lie around the corner.

For now, he could only lie in wait, hoping for his soup to cool soon.
